2x+2y=8 in function form step by step please?

You could get two different functions out of this:

<u>2x + 2y = 8</u>

1). <u> 'y' as a function of 'x'</u>

Subtract  2x  from each side:  2y  = -2x + 8

Divide each side by  2 :         <em> y  =  -x + 4</em>


2). <u> 'x' as a function of 'y' :</u>

Subtract  2y  from each side:    2x  =  -2y + 8

Divide each side by  2 :        <em>  x  =  -y + 4</em>

Those two functions look the same, but that's just because the original
equation given in the problem was so symmetrical.  In general, they're
not the same function.
